Job Overview

RPM Development Group is seeking a highly skilled Regional Property Manager to join our team. As a key member of our management team, you will be responsible for overseeing the operations of our affordable housing properties, ensuring they meet our high standards of quality and sustainability.

Key Responsibilities

  • Manage and mentor District Managers and Property Managers to ensure they are operating within budget and maintaining a high level of curb appeal.
  • Complete and review annual budgets with Property Managers, providing guidance to ensure properties are operating within budget and reviewing variances monthly.
  • Act as a liaison between Property Managers and Leasing Managers on new lease-ups, assisting in coordinating marketing and reporting to government agencies as needed.
  • Work with Facilities Manager to propose and oversee capital improvement projects, ensuring properties are maintained to RPM standards and preventive maintenance initiatives are completed timely and within budget.
  • Perform other duties as needed to advance the goals of the company.

Requirements

  • Excellent leadership skills with the ability to work collaboratively and motivate a diverse team.
  • Strong financial acumen with an understanding of budgets, operating statements, and reporting.
  • Knowledge of project-based section 8, LIHTC/Tax Credit, and other subsidized housing programs.
  • Excellent time management and organizational skills with the ability to meet deadlines and prioritize multiple projects.
  • Ability to work in a fast-paced environment and make decisive business decisions as needed.

Education and Experience

  • Bachelor's degree in business administration, communications, or a related field.
  • Minimum 3 years of experience as a Regional/District Manager and 5+ years of prior residential on-site management experience.
  • Knowledge of both affordable housing and market-rate housing.
  • Technology literacy and a solid understanding of operating software, Yardi experience preferred.
  • Industry training credentials authenticating understanding of rental housing programs.
  • Valid driver's license, insured vehicle, and ability to travel between properties.
